Transaction 76003fa647bf916b63c948a3c833974524557ded6d02276755e8859caa8d7390
1 Input
2 Outputs
- 76003fa647bf916b63c948a3c833974524557ded6d02276755e8859caa8d7390:0
- 76003fa647bf916b63c948a3c833974524557ded6d02276755e8859caa8d7390:1
value 16918814
address 18tBd47NnbwY2A93YgkbGo9UYZ2xgKKqx3
value 127869692
address 1Meu79zkEAcyTBzDHfDhXR9z4DWLDDEazt